Output 8377fdcb69b250a5e76c48a19a7c60b112190d85a7753787fe2a6ce2d3ab117f:178

value
97692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3054c218bb96c8a61a58e9aa09ea361327c4fb4 OP_EQUAL
address
3Lvnr67CDSQRqtcfsXoGwUJrpPmd61rBbS
transaction
8377fdcb69b250a5e76c48a19a7c60b112190d85a7753787fe2a6ce2d3ab117f
confirmations
435528
spent
true